The Medieval Fair of Torre de Moncorvo, located in the north of Portugal, has several editions since 2011, and itshistorical context is associated with D. Dinis and iron. This event stands out from other medieval fairs for the involvement of the local population. Thus, the present study aimed to analyze the profile of the Medieval Fair visitor, considering the following objectives: identify the visitor profile; determine visitor motivations; assess the level of visitor satisfaction; analyze visitor behavioral intentions. A quantitative methodology was adopted with the application of a questionnaire survey to visitors of the fair. The questionnaire was applied in two formats, on paper and online, obtaining 300 responses.A factor analysis was also performed, where three motivational factors and one attraction factor were found. Based on the factors identified, it can be concluded that visitors to the Medieval Fair of Torre de Moncorvo are attracted to this event for cultural reasons, seeking to relax and socialize, and are willing to recommend the municipality and the event, and return at the next opportunity. The results of the study can help the organization of the event to adjust the next editions of the fair to the profile of the visitor.
